Output 3709c3aa5563d2a786680c76c6d5249cc8eb79b1b85ad5dc304530e46d496456:4

value
134936
script pubkey
OP_0 OP_PUSHBYTES_20 510fac655e5b93c71afda2dd0b4711a1a50f623d
address
bc1q2y86ce27twfuwxha5twsk3c35xjs7c3avxs6hs
transaction
3709c3aa5563d2a786680c76c6d5249cc8eb79b1b85ad5dc304530e46d496456
confirmations
24851
spent
true